The Distinction Between Live-In Care and 24-Hour Care

Standard live-in care typically involves one caregiver who works up to 10 hours per day and is available for ad hoc care needs during the night. However, the caregiver should not be woken up more than three times per night. This level of care is suitable for individuals who require assistance but do not have medical conditions that demand continuous monitoring.

On the other hand, 24-hour care is intended exclusively for seniors with medical disorders that demand round-the-clock attention and treatment. A skilled Comfort Keepers caregiver is always on hand, whether it's for treating long-term conditions like Parkinson's Disease, a terminal illness, or supporting people with mobility problems.

Preventing Accidents and Ensuring Safety

Seniors are more likely to have accidents at home as they age. Falls and other accidents can be caused by conditions like limited movement, poor vision, diminished depth perception, and decreased cognitive function. Osteoporosis, weak muscles, and conditions like arthritis all increase the likelihood of tripping or falling.

The bathroom is one space in the house that presents a particularly serious risk. Accidents in the bathroom frequently happen when people lose their balance when getting in or out of the bath or shower or when they slide on damp floors. Seniors who fall can suffer serious repercussions, including painful fractures that take a long time to heal.

If you or your loved one has a history of falls at home or is experiencing confusion during the day or night, 24-hour care can significantly reduce the risk of serious accidents. With a qualified care professional present at all times, there is always a safe pair of hands to provide immediate assistance and prevent any potential harm.

The Benefits of Around-the-Clock Care

Around-the-clock care offers numerous benefits for seniors and their families. Let's explore some of the key advantages:

1. Continuous Monitoring and Medical Support

Individuals with complex medical conditions are guaranteed round-the-clock monitoring and assistance from medical professionals. Seniors with later stages of chronic illnesses benefit especially from this level of care. When a senior's health changes, our caregivers can react quickly, remind them to take their medication as prescribed, and seek emergency assistance if it’s needed.

2. Enhanced Safety and Security

With a care professional available at all times, seniors can feel secure and confident in their own homes. The presence of a qualified caregiver reduces the risk of accidents, provides assistance with daily activities, and offers a sense of security during the night. Families can have peace of mind knowing that their loved ones are in safe hands when they can’t be there.

3. Personalized Care and Companionship

Around-the-clock It makes it possible to create individualized care plans that are specific to each person's requirements. To ensure that seniors receive the best possible care and companionship, our caregivers get to know their routines, personal preferences, and health needs.

4. Emotional and Social Support

Seniors who require round-the-clock care may feel isolated and lonely. Being surrounded by a committed care provider offers emotional support and company. Caregivers interact with our seniors in meaningful ways, partake in activities with them, and provide a comforting presence that can help seniors feel much better emotionally.

5. Assistance with Activities of Daily Living

Activities of daily living (ADLs) help is frequently needed by senior citizens with complex care needs. These tasks include clothing, grooming, preparing meals, managing medications, and assisting with movement. Seniors who receive round-the-clock care can get the help they require whenever they do, assuring their comfort and dignity.
